On Mon, Dec 01, 2003 at 03:59:04PM -0600, Casey Harkins wrote:
> Another possibility since .jar's are usually self contained, would be to
> use /usr/lib/jar. This would keep /usr/lib or /usr/share from getting
> filled with sub-directories containing single jar files.
I'll probably go with /usr/share/<package/, many apps (including this
one) have a bunch of .jars that they carry around, and if I can just set
the classpath up in the script for one directory, it'll make life
easier, and ensure that nothing else overwrites them with a different
version. Actually, it has a couple of platform dependant libs too, I'll
pop them in /usr/lib/<package>.
